近期,腾讯云在开发者社区中掀起了广泛讨论,原因为其新发布的Node.js SDK 4.0版本遭到了一位名为batchor的开发者的吐槽。他在GitHub上指出,腾讯云的Node.js SDK打包后的体积近100MB,让众多开发者感到不适,而相比之下,竞争对手亚马逊云(AWS)的SDK仅有13MB,这一差异显得尤为突出。对这一反馈,众多开发者纷纷表示认同,截止到目前,batchor的评论已收获2198个点赞,这显示了开发者对SDK体积问题的普遍关注,反映了行业内部对轻量化、模块化开发需求的渴望。
在面对此次质疑,腾讯云团队的成员zqfan在GitHub的Issues下进行了快速的回应,通过致歉与说明来应对这种开发者的忧虑。他指出,体积差异的根本原因在于腾讯云采用了全产品的总包方式,而AWS则是通过按需分包的策略,开发者只需下载所需模块,这种方式有效降低了SDK的实际体积。这一信息的传达,使得开发者对腾讯云当前的设计方案有了更深入的理解。
然而,zqfan并未止步于解释,进一步透露腾讯云同样提供分包使用的方案。开发者可以依据自身的需求,选择只下载特定功能的分包,从而减小SDK的体积。此举不仅为开发者提供了选择的灵活性,还帮助他们在项目中优化依赖管理,提升整体开发效率。
结合这一事件,我们可见,腾讯云正逐步走向用户需求导向的开发模式。通过实时的用户反馈,不断调整优化产品以适应时代发展是现代云计算服务商的必然趋势。面对竞争激烈的云服务市场,开发者对于轻量化、简洁化的需求愈加迫切,腾讯云如能真的实现这些改进,无疑会打破现今市场对其产品的固有印象。
从技术角度来看,Node.js SDK的提升,涉及到机器学习、深度学习等前端技术的应用,而在云服务的未来,集成更多的智能化功能与服务,将会是主要的发展趋势。随着AI和大数据技术的持续发展,云服务提供商如腾讯云需紧跟时代潮流,注重产品的高效性和响应速度,以提高用户体验。
这次SDK体积之争不仅是开发者们在技术讨论中的一种发声,也是推动云服务技术不断前行的机遇。未来腾讯云是否能在快速反馈中实现自身产品的优化与调整,将会成为业界热议的话题。开发者的需求往往能直接引导企业的技术更新迭代,面对这样的市场动向,腾讯云若能及时吸纳行业反馈,这不仅能提升其市场竞争力,亦可以为开发者创造更加友好的开发环境。
总结来说,腾讯云Node.js SDK的体积问题引发的讨论,将会成为腾讯云改进自身产品的一个重要契机。面对日益激烈的行业竞争和开发者的呼声,腾讯云需将轻量化、模块化作为未来发展的方向。对于广大开发者而言,选择合适的SDK以及灵活运用各种开发工具,正好体现出当今编程理念的不断进步。接下来,开发者们可以关注腾讯云的动态,了解其在技术产品上的更新,及时掌握新工具的应用以及如何最大化提高工作效率,让开发过程变得更加轻松。